I'm running Arch in my ESXi lab with Gnome 3.16 and would like to set the resolution to 1920x1080.
However the max resolution I can run is 1360x768 and it says the display is unknown.
I've installed the xf86-video-vmware driver but I'm not sure if Xorg is using that or not.
Is there a way to force Xorg to use a specific driver? Any help with correcting this would be much appreciated. Thanks.

I wasn't able to get Xorg to use a specific driver but I was able to get high resolutions by first increasing the graphics memory and then using xrandr --fb 1920x1080 to set it to that specific resolution. I wasn't able to use the GUI to set it to that that resolution so I had to use xrandr.
